Mazda in the black with track-inspired MX-5

Japanese carmaker aims to inject fresh life into the venerable MX-5 and 2 hatchback via black-themed limited-edition models aimed at the UK market

Mercedes-Benz and Porsche already churn out basic-black (at least in name) special editions of some of their models – dubbed Black Series and Black Edition respectively – but now Mazda is getting in on the noir theme via ‘Black Limited Edition’ variants of the MX-5 and 2 hatchback, aimed solely at the UK market.


The MX-5 Sport Black was inspired by the MX-5 GT race car that competes in the Britcar Production GTN Championship, and just 500 examples will be offered for sale.


The MX-5 GT racer ekes out 205kW and weighs just 850kg – enabling it to harass more powerful Lotus, BMW and Ferrari rivals – but the Black Limited Edition retains the same hardware as the standard road car, with the makeover being restricted to cosmetics.


Although it will be available in Velocity Red, Spirited Green or Crystal white, the limited-run roadster lives up to its moniker via a ‘Brilliant Black’ retractable hard-top and dark gunmetal 17-inch alloys.


Inside, it scores black leather interior with contrasting sand coloured stitching and piano-black trim on the steering wheel spokes and dashboard. Befitting its status, it gets the mandatory ‘Black Limited Edition’ badges on the bodywork, along with a uniquely numbered interior plaque and Limited Edition floor mats.


Standard kit includes climate control air-conditioning, a premium Bose audio system, an integrated hands-free Bluetooth system, cruise control and front fog lights. Mazda claims the powered retractable roof, which goes up or down in 12 seconds, is still the fastest of its type, despite the advent of newer folding hardtop-equipped convertibles.


Meanwhile, those on a tighter budget are catered to via the Mazda2 Black, of which 618 examples will be flogged, each with a black vinyl roof, privacy glass, front fog lights and 16-inch matt black alloy wheels.


As per the MX-5 Black, it will be offered in red, green and white, with power coming from a 62kW 1.3-litre engine.
